Water Quality and Temperature Guidelines

Crafting the perfect cup of Elegance Brew coffee requires understanding the critical role of water. Water quality and temperature are key factors that dramatically influence the flavor, aroma, and overall experience of your coffee.

Optimal Water Temperature Range

Selecting the right water temperature for coffee is crucial for extracting the best flavors. Professional baristas recommend brewing temperatures between 195°F and 205°F (90°C to 96°C). This specific range ensures optimal extraction without introducing bitter or sour notes.

  • Too low: Underextracted, weak coffee
  • Too high: Burnt, bitter taste
  • Ideal range: Balanced, rich flavor profile

Importance of Filtered Water

Filtered water plays a significant role in brewing exceptional coffee. Tap water often contains minerals and chlorine that can mask the delicate flavor notes of Elegance Brew coffee. Using high-quality filtered water removes impurities and allows the true coffee characteristics to shine through.

Water-to-Coffee Ratio

The coffee-to-water ratio is another critical element in brewing. A standard recommendation is 1:16 - one part coffee to sixteen parts water. This ratio provides a balanced and consistent brew.

  1. For a strong cup: Use a 1:14 ratio
  2. For a lighter brew: Use a 1:18 ratio
  3. Adjust to personal taste preferences

Grind Size Guidelines

Different brewing methods require specific coffee grind sizes to achieve optimal extraction. Here's a quick guide to help you navigate grinding techniques:

  • Coarse grind: Ideal for French press and cold brew
  • Medium grind: Perfect for drip coffee makers
  • Fine grind: Best for espresso and Turkish coffee
  • Medium-fine grind: Suitable for pour-over methods

Timing Your Grind

Fresh ground coffee delivers the most vibrant and complex flavors. Grinding your beans immediately before brewing preserves the delicate aromatic compounds that quickly dissipate after grinding. Aim to grind only the amount of coffee you'll use within 15-20 minutes to maintain peak freshness.

Common Grinding Mistakes to Avoid

Coffee enthusiasts often make critical errors when grinding their beans. Watch out for these common pitfalls:

  1. Using a blade grinder that creates uneven particle sizes
  2. Grinding beans too far in advance
  3. Neglecting to clean your coffee grinder regularly
  4. Using the wrong grind size for your brewing method

Investing in a quality burr grinder can dramatically improve your coffee grinding techniques and help you consistently produce delicious, fresh ground coffee that showcases the true potential of Elegance Brew beans.

Mastering the Pour-Over Method

Pour-over coffee represents the pinnacle of manual brewing methods, offering coffee enthusiasts unprecedented control over their brewing process. This technique allows for remarkable coffee brewing precision, transforming an ordinary cup into an extraordinary sensory experience.

To master pour-over coffee, you'll need specific equipment and techniques that elevate your brewing skills. The right approach can unlock complex flavor profiles and create a truly remarkable cup of coffee.

  • Select a high-quality pour-over dripper with consistent flow rate
  • Choose fresh, medium-grind coffee beans
  • Use a gooseneck kettle for precise water distribution
  • Maintain water temperature between 195-205°F

The key to exceptional pour-over coffee lies in your pouring technique. Start by wetting the grounds gently, allowing them to bloom for 30 seconds. This initial step releases trapped gases and prepares the coffee for optimal extraction.

Pour water in slow, concentric circles, maintaining a consistent stream. Avoid aggressive pouring that might disrupt the coffee bed. The goal is steady, controlled movement that ensures even saturation and maximum flavor development.

Proper Steeping Duration

Brewing time plays a crucial role in extracting the perfect flavor profile. Different brewing methods demand unique steeping times:

  • French Press: 4-5 minutes for optimal extraction
  • Cold Brew: 12-24 hours for smooth, low-acid coffee
  • Pour-Over: 2-3 minutes for balanced flavor
